Does everyone really think this scheme is worth spending the extra money on, if you don't normally buy the papers? I've been collecting from the start and used it to get vouchers for Pizza Express (which seemed to give the best value) for a free 2-course meal. Before the Daily Mail changed the way the Rewards Club works, you needed 7 vouchers.
Maybe some people can tell me if they think it's worth continuing to collect for something else which does actually save some money. I've got 6000 just now. Thanks to anyone who can help.
Congrats on being patient enough to bank 4 timesI was actually forced to stop when taking a holiday under the old system, then it changed and I restarted. Like TM6 a relative sometimes buys the Saturday paper and when I can't get that help then I deliberately use Nectar/Clubcard points/vouchers to offset the cost of the Mail on Sunday - if not the Tesco gift card itself from the last time.
I noticed the cinema changes and the fact that that means waiting until you've got 3000 before you can claim a ticket, though to be fair it would only be another fortnight before you could get a cheaper £5 reward for supermarkets and Robert Dyas.
So as you've said, there are some combinations where the scheme's not worth it anymore eg for Pizza Express, if you think you want to quit then it'll be at the next bank mark and you have to take your choice then.0 -
